Hungary to donate 200,000 vaccines to Egypt

Hungary is sending 200,000 doses of the coronavirus vaccine to Egypt as aid to boost the vaccination campaign and strengthen virus protection efforts in the north African country, Foreign Minister Péter Szijjártó said on Wednesday in a video on Facebook.
 
Speaking from Liszt Ferenc International Airport ahead of a visit to Africa, Szijjártó called Egypt key to European security. Egypt has
 
successfully stemmed the flow of migrants
 
from its territory to Europe for the past five years, he said. “Egypt’s success, security and stability are important for us,” he said. With the vaccine shipment to Egypt, the number of doses Hungary donated to other countries has surpassed 2.5 million, Szijjártó said.
